About this event

Wednesday 5 November | 6.30 - 7.30pm | The Enterprise Centre, UEA

Dr Nussaibah Younis is a peacebuilding practitioner and a globally recognised expert on contemporary Iraq. Shortlisted for the Women’s Prize for Fiction 2025, Younis’ debut novel Fundamentally is a bitingly original, wildly funny and razor-sharp exploration of love, family, religion and the decisions we make in pursuit of belonging.
